    I have been running NIS 2006 now since late December and so far I can say I have been pretty pleased with it and how it runs. It does not seem to use as much resources as the pre 2005 releases did but it is not truly light either. I think it runs best on the newer hardware and lots of Ram. As for protection on my system,Ihave not had a single infection so far so I feel pretty confident it is doing its job ok for me. Its actually funny thatbefore I bought the NIS 2006 package I was running Avast! Pro which used to run quite well but afterone of the program updates last year it started bogging my system down like I had never seen before. I could never resolve it and switched to NIS. The same exact machine running the entire NIS suite ran much faster than Avast! did. Anyway, I still like Avast! and think I will mostlikely give it a try againin the near future but I will run this NIS suite till the expire date which is in another year before I switch again.
